Lawrence "L.E.-Larry" Davis, age 76, of Melrose, New Mexico passed away at his home Monday, December 28, 2009. He was born November 16, 1933, in Riverside, California to Honley "H.D.-Dwight" and Sadie Bell Barto Davis.
He served in the United States Marine Corps where he was a veteran of the Korean War. L.E. came to Clovis in 1968 where he farmed and ranched the family homestead until his death. He enjoyed mechanic work, raising cattle and at an early age raced motorcycles. He was a member of the VFW Post 3280, Clovis - Portales Elks Lodge 1244, American Legion Post 25, and had been attending the Melrose Methodist Church.
He is survived by his son, Larry and wife, Terri Davis of Melrose; two daughters, Donna Fay Davis and Rhonda Lynn Davis both of Bloomington, California; five grandchildren; six great grandchildren; two brothers, Dwight Junior Davis of Riverside, California and William R. "Bill" Davis of Albuquerque, New Mexico.
He is preceded in death by his wife, Lola Davis; grandson, Dwight Davis, and two sisters.
Graveside Services will be held on Saturday, January 2, 2010, at 2:00 p.m. at the Field Cemetery, in Field, New Mexico with Grady Bright officiating. The family will gather at the Field Volunteer Fire Department after the service. Military Honors will be conducted by the United States Marines. Honorary pallbearers are the members of VFW Post 3280.
